Restriction and AND - SQL
Restriction is available via the WHERE operator, and so it is in SQL. However, by Example showing how a certain simple restriction can be expressed using JOIN and a relation literal. It is useful to show SQL's counterpart of that example, giving the student ids of students named Boris.
Example: joining with a table literal
SELECT DISTINCT StudentId
FROM IS_CALLED NATURAL JOIN (VALUES ('Boris')) AS T(Name)
The columns of a table literal in SQL are anonymous. When a table literal is an operand in a table expression the only way of assigning names to its columns is by giving them in the definition of a range variable-AS T(Name) in the example.
